Output 61f95a306e14c183fa956c3e85f46630fb45d63cc42c3313d487a32af7e7e491:1

value
4530340162
script pubkey
OP_0 OP_PUSHBYTES_20 de1059e7e9cefb40f3250b8e2772b026ad9d0d05
address
tb1qmcg9nelfema5pue9pw8zwu4sy6ke6rg93ta9y2
transaction
61f95a306e14c183fa956c3e85f46630fb45d63cc42c3313d487a32af7e7e491